Comparison review

Galaxy Tab A7 Lite has a global score of 74.2, which is much better than Galaxy Tab 2 (7.0)'s 60.7 general score. Both of these tablets work with Android OS (operating system), but the Galaxy Tab A7 Lite has a more recent 11 version while Galaxy Tab 2 (7.0) has Android 4.1 version. Galaxy Tab A7 Lite is a way newer and notably thinner portable tablet than Galaxy Tab 2 (7.0), but it's just a little heavier.

The Samsung Galaxy Tab A7 Lite counts with a way better processing power than Galaxy Tab 2 (7.0), because it has more cores and 2 GB more RAM memory. Samsung Galaxy Tab 2 (7.0) features a little bit better looking display than Galaxy Tab A7 Lite, although it has a little bit lower pixels count per screen inch, a way lower resolution of 600 x 1024px and a bit smaller screen.

Galaxy Tab A7 Lite features a way better camera than Samsung Galaxy Tab 2 (7.0), because it has a back camera with lot more mega-pixels and a way better 1920x1080 video quality. The Samsung Galaxy Tab A7 Lite counts with much more memory capacity for games and applications than Galaxy Tab 2 (7.0), and although they both have equal 32 GB internal storage capacity, the Samsung Galaxy Tab A7 Lite also has an external SD slot that allows a maximum of 1 TB.

The Galaxy Tab A7 Lite counts with superior battery performance than Galaxy Tab 2 (7.0), because it has a 28% larger battery capacity.

Galaxy Tab A7 Lite costs a bit more than the Galaxy Tab 2 (7.0), but you can get a much better tablet for that few extra dollars.
